Turnarounds generate thousands of activities, multiple contractor interfaces, changing priorities, and time-sensitive decisions. While traditional reports often provide historical information, digital dashboards enable teams to monitor current performance, identify emerging issues, and respond before small problems become major delays.

As industrial facilities continue to embrace digital transformation, dashboards are becoming an essential component of turnaround management, providing a single, reliable view of planning, execution, monitoring, and safety throughout the event.

Turning Operational Data into Actionable Decisions

A dashboard is far more than a visual reporting tool. It consolidates information from multiple workstreams into one accessible platform, helping planners, supervisors, and leadership teams maintain situational awareness throughout the turnaround.

Rather than relying on disconnected spreadsheets or manual updates, decision-makers can quickly review work progress, resource status, material availability, safety indicators, and key performance metrics from a centralized interface.

This improved visibility enables faster responses to changing site conditions while keeping teams aligned with turnaround objectives.

How Digital Dashboards Support Every Turnaround Phase

During the 2025 STOT Saudi Conference, organized by Energia Middle East, Turki Alqahtani, Turnaround Digital Transformation Consultant at Saudi Aramco, presented how SGPD’s digital transformation integrated specialized dashboards across the entire turnaround lifecycle instead of relying on a single reporting system.

The presentation demonstrated dedicated dashboards for:

Turnaround FunctionOperational Visibility
Planning DashboardScope preparation, material tracking, logistics readiness, contractual preparation, and job card status.
Execution DashboardDaily progress tracking, QA/QC monitoring, contractor utilization, and implementation of best practices.
Monitoring DashboardCost tracking, material consumption, and KPI performance throughout execution.
Safety DashboardHSE performance, risk mitigation activities, and lessons learned for continuous improvement.

This layered approach allows each functional team to monitor the information most relevant to their responsibilities while providing leadership with a comprehensive overview of turnaround performance.

Better Visibility Leads to Better Outcomes

Digital dashboards contribute value by improving both operational awareness and decision quality. When project teams have access to live performance indicators, they can:

  • Detect schedule deviations before they affect critical milestones.
  • Monitor contractor productivity throughout execution.
  • Track material availability and procurement status.
  • Review KPI performance against turnaround objectives.
  • Strengthen communication across planning, operations, maintenance, and HSE teams.

The result is faster issue resolution, improved coordination, and greater confidence in daily operational decisions.

Industrial turnarounds have always required teams to work under demanding conditions, from confined spaces and elevated structures to hazardous process units. While these activities are essential for maintaining plant reliability, they also introduce safety risks, schedule pressure, and operational complexity.

Today, robotics is transforming the way maintenance work is executed. Instead of replacing skilled personnel, robotic technologies are allowing teams to complete inspections, cleaning, repairs, and testing with greater precision while reducing human exposure to hazardous environments. As the industry advances, Energia Middle East continues to bring together owner-operators, technology innovators, and maintenance leaders to share practical strategies that improve turnaround performance across the region.

Why Robotics Is Becoming Essential During Turnarounds

Modern turnaround projects demand more than speed—they require safer execution without compromising quality. Robotics enables organizations to perform high-risk tasks remotely, minimize unnecessary human entry into dangerous areas, and collect accurate operational data throughout the turnaround lifecycle.

The benefits extend beyond safety, helping operators improve productivity and make better maintenance decisions.

Key Advantages of Robotic Turnaround Solutions

  • Reduces personnel exposure to hazardous and confined environments.
  • Performs inspections with greater accuracy and consistency.
  • Supports faster turnaround execution by minimizing manual intervention.
  • Improves asset condition monitoring through digital data collection.
  • Enhances overall schedule reliability while reducing operational risk.

Robotics Applications Across Industrial Turnarounds

Robotic TechnologyOperational Benefit
UAV InspectionInspects elevated structures without scaffolding or rope access.
Tank Cleaning RobotsCleans storage tanks while reducing confined-space entry.
Piping Inspection CrawlersDetects internal defects with minimal system disruption.
Piping Cleaning CrawlersImproves pipe cleanliness while reducing manual cleaning effort.
Robotic Blasting & Coating SystemsDelivers consistent surface preparation and coating quality.
Hydrocarbon Robotic VacuumRemoves hazardous materials while limiting worker exposure.
Automatic Welding SystemsImproves weld quality and repeatability while shortening repair time.
Mechanical Crawlers & Specialized Maintenance ToolsSupports safer maintenance in difficult-to-access plant locations.

These technologies demonstrate how robotics is evolving from a specialized capability into a practical component of modern turnaround execution.

A successful shutdown begins long before the first piece of equipment is taken offline. In gas processing facilities, effective planning is critical to balancing maintenance requirements with production targets, resource availability, and operational continuity.

As gas demand continues to grow across Saudi Arabia and the GCC, shutdown planning has become increasingly complex. Even well-prepared organizations face challenges that can affect schedules, costs, and overall turnaround performance.

Five Common Planning Challenges

1. Balancing Production and Maintenance

Shutdowns are essential for maintaining asset reliability, but taking critical equipment offline can affect production commitments. Planning teams must carefully coordinate maintenance activities while minimizing operational disruption.

2. Coordinating Multiple Stakeholders

Operations, maintenance, engineering, supply chain, and contractors all play a role in a successful shutdown. Aligning priorities, responsibilities, and schedules across these teams remains one of the biggest planning challenges.

3. Managing Outage Schedules

Gas facilities often operate within tight maintenance windows. Unexpected scope changes or scheduling conflicts can quickly impact turnaround timelines, making early planning and coordination essential.

4. Improving Planning Accuracy

Reliable shutdown planning depends on accurate production forecasts, equipment data, and maintenance priorities. Better planning models help organizations evaluate different scenarios before execution begins, reducing uncertainty during the turnaround.

5. Optimizing Resources

From skilled personnel to spare parts and contractor availability, every resource must be available at the right time. Poor resource planning can lead to delays, increased costs, and extended shutdown durations.

During STOT Saudi, held 19–21 May 2025, one of the standout technical sessions examined a topic central to every turnaround cycle: Shutdown & Turnaround Safety Hazards, presented by Mohammed Hatooq .

Now, nearly a year later, the insights shared remain highly relevant as the industry prepares for its next wave of scheduled shutdowns.

Turnarounds as Risk Concentration Events

The session began by redefining what a turnaround truly represents: a planned, periodic shutdown of a process unit or plant for inspection, overhaul, and repair .

However, what makes these events complex is scale:

  • 1–2+ year intervals
  • 2–4x workforce increase
  • Significant cost exposure

Rather than viewing TAMs as routine maintenance, the session framed them as periods of intensified risk density.

Time pressure, contractor expansion, and simultaneous high-risk tasks combine to create operational conditions that differ sharply from steady-state production.

The Compounding Effect of Parallel Activities

From line breaking to confined space entry, from scaffolding to welding, the presentation mapped how multiple applications overlap during turnaround windows .

Each task brings its own hazard profile—but the real risk lies in their interaction.

For attendees, this systems-level framing was particularly valuable. It shifted focus from isolated safety controls to integrated risk planning.

Why It Mattered

The key takeaway from the 2025 session was simple but powerful:

Turnaround safety must be engineered—not assumed.
